Rabbit-Proof Fence


Back in the 1930s, it was Australian government policy to remove children of mixed race from their Aboriginal surroundings, and send them away to ''boarding school'' to be raised as whites. This is the tale of three such girls, who decide to rather return home. Problem is, home is about 2000 km away, and their only way of getting there is to walk...
